Extended Data Fig. 7: SLC25A51 overexpression influences the plasma metabolome during liver regeneration.

From: Hepatocyte mitochondrial NAD+ content is limiting for liver regeneration

Extended Data Fig. 7

Metabolomic profile of plasma acquired from SLC25A51 overexpressing (OE) and eGFP control mice pre and 48 h post hepatectomy. a-b, Depleted and enriched metabolites during regeneration in eGFP (a) and A51 overexpressing (b) mice. Significant metabolites were determined by p < 0.05 from an unpaired two-tailed Student’s t-test. c, Correlation plots of log2 fold change were plotted from plasma by selecting all significant metabolites within the eGFP comparison alone, OE comparison alone or a shared (common) subset. d-e, Joint pathway analysis of significant metabolites and proteins (p < 0.05 from Student’s t-test) from liver tissue of eGFP controls (d) and SLC25A51 overexpressing (e) livers using MetaboAnalyst 6.045, (n = 5 mice for eGFP control and n = 6-8 for A51 OE).
